A methodology and a software package for calculating the fertilizer mixture component doses depending on the data on the variability of agrochemical indicators and agricultural crops planned for cultivation are discussed. The software package can be used by both agricultural enterprises and fertilizer manufacturers with fertilizer mixing plants for the production of fertilizer mixtures for the soil, climatic and economic conditions of the end consumer.

The productivity of technological processes in agriculture is determined by the set of transport and technological means used. The article describes the models for the unification of shift performance, taking into account a wide range of agricultural cargoes and a large number of works on their movement in the process of cultivation and harvesting of agricultural crops. A step-by-step modeling of scenarios for the use of transport and technological means was carried out on the basis of the optimality criterion and forecasting the period of agricultural work. They confirmed that the objective function is of theoretical and practical interest, as it helps to determine the optimal values of the power of technical means, depending on the combination of production conditions. The numerical value of power obtained by calculation can serve as a guide for manufacturers of agricultural machinery in the development of promising vehicles for a specific consumer, depending on the availability of resources and production and economic conditions.

The contradiction between the profitable work of agriculture and the lack of its simple reproduction is revealed. Profits of agricultural enterprises are secured by a strict restriction on all major items of expenditure, including labor costs, which farmers are forced to go to due to the low profitability of the industry. They have to tighten their belts more and more, saving even on the necessary things. At the same time, monopolized suppliers of resources to agriculture and network trading networks, which are oligopolies, continue to siphon resources from producers of products. The author emphasizes the nature of perfect competition of the mass of agricultural producers, to which the market economy should strive. The term “market hinterland” is introduced, which characterizes the current situation of agriculture, which is economically disadvantaged by its counterparties. This intersectoral imbalance is not eliminated and is not compensated by the state, since the subsidies allocated are not enough even to bring the wages of agricultural workers to the average size in the Russian economy. The conclusion is made about the weak state regulation of intersectoral relations, which should limit monopolies and oligopolies and create equal economic conditions for different industries and also about the need for a significant increase in state support for agriculture.

The approach to solving the problems of diagnosis and prognosis of diseases of agricultural crops using machine learning methods is described. To solve the problem of forecasting diseases of agricultural crops, it is proposed to use a genetic algorithm in the work. The analysis of the effectiveness of the proposed method is carried out depending on the convergence rate of such parameters as the mutation coefficient and population size. To solve the problem of diagnostics of agricultural crops, it is proposed to use a recurrent type of neural network. A software modelling complex has been developed that allows solving the problems of plant diseases diagnostics and making forecasts. The results obtained can reduce the costs of agricultural enterprises by reducing the cost of diagnosing agricultural diseases.

The article covers aspects of financial condition analysis regarding creditworthiness of Ukrainian agricultural enterprises that had to operate in unstable economic conditions in 2009-2017. It is proposed to improve methodological approaches to financial assessment of an enterprise – a potential borrower, due to changes in the economy, in particular in the financial sector, which have been influenced by crises that have shaken the Ukrainian economy twice in the past ten years. The proposed approaches to assessing the financial condition of an agricultural enterprise as a component of its creditworthiness increase the accuracy and credibility of such assessments and help to minimize credit risks.

The article provides a comprehensive analysis of the current state, reasonably promising directions for the development of microirrigation methods in Ukraine through the prism of climatic transformations. The dynamics of the areas of agricultural crops irrigated using microirrigation methods in the world and in Ukraine, as well as the structure of the areas of micro-irrigation in the context of regions of Ukraine and types of crops are shown. The largest agricultural enterprises, which are domestic leaders in the introduction of microirrigation methods, equipment manufacturers and suppliers of technical means of microirrigation, have been identified. The current stage of development of microirrigation in Ukraine is defined as a level of high understanding of technologies of its application and constantly growing use of opportunities and expansion of spheres of application of these methods of irrigation. The essential importance of domestic research institutions in the development and popularization of microirrigation methods is emphasized. With the use of theoretical methods of scientific research (analysis and synthesis, comparison, classification and generalization), the most significant scientific results of IWPaLM NAAS are systematized and a list of prepared regulatory and methodological documents in the direction of microirrigation is given. The need of Ukraine in microirrigation systems for agricultural crops for the period up to 2030 is given, trends and promising directions for the development of microirrigation methods that correspond to both the global trend of environmentally friendly irrigation and the principles of resource and energy conservation are given. The importance of state support for the introduction of microirrigation methods in terms of increasing the amount of budgetary allocations under the existing programs of state support for the agricultural sector of the Ukrainian economy is determined.

This paper presents a new approach to deal with agricultural crop recognition using SVM (Support Vector Machine), applied to time series of NDVI images. The presented method can be divided into two steps. First, the Timesat software package is used to extract a set of crop features from the NDVI time series. These features serve as descriptors that characterize each NDVI vegetation curve, i.e., the period comprised between sowing and harvesting dates. Then, it is used an SVM to learn the patterns that define each type of crop, and create a crop model that allows classifying new series. The authors present a set of experiments that show the effectiveness of this technique. They evaluated their algorithm with a collection of more than 3000 time series from the Brazilian State of Mato Grosso spanning 4 years (2009-2013). Such time series were annotated in the field by specialists from Embrapa (Brazilian Agricultural Research Corporation). This methodology is generic, and can be adapted to distinct regions and crop profiles.

A set of computer programs for the formation of the tractor fleet, taking into account its quantitative and age composition, technical level, loss and shortage of products associated with the deviation of the agrotechnical period in the non-Chernozem zone of Russia and the annual cost of repair and maintenance of tractors. The program is universal for any structure of Park of farms and any region. The menu of program modules is presented. The program will rationally complete the machine and tractor fleet of agricultural enterprises, as well as more reasonably choose the direction of development of the tractor design and determine the most cost-effective, performance and design characteristics of tractor models at the design or procurement stage.
